Necker Island
British Virgin Islands
After its destruction by Hurricane Irma, Necker Island reopened in 2021 following a 2yr closure. The new Necker Island has been restored to its former glory and brings to life a new vision of hospitality excellence in the Caribbean. Famous for being Branson’s personal home (he lives on the island) guests can buyout the full island for a mere $134K per night. The rates are all-inclusive and the island has 20 rooms, so up to 40 guests can takeover the island for their own private playground complete with the famous Necker tennis courts (home to the annual Necker Cup), amazing wildlife habitats (giant tortoises, lemurs, flamingo beach, etc) and unique accommodations that are all perched across the island. Furthering the island’s commitment towards sustainability and renewable energy, three giant new wind turbines were installed meaning the island runs on ~100% renewable energy every day.
